Korea Research Institute for Vocational Education and Training (KRIVET) is a national research institute affiliated with the Prime Minister’s Office which was established in 1997 for vitalization of vocational education and training (VET) and enhancement of the public’s vocational competencies.

Since its foundation, in order to support the public’s lifelong skills development, KRIVET has been conducting policy research and development in the field of education and employment, which are a necessary part of our daily lives, including Specialized high school, Meister high school and vocational college policies, employment expansion, reducing skills mismatch, development of National Competency Standards based curriculum, Work-Study Dual program and national qualification framework, evaluation of training programs, and provision of career information.

Its vision is to be a research institute realizing the stable life for all individuals. Its goal is to activate technical and vocational education and training through research on vocational competency and develop the capacity of citizens.
